One or more items in "file name" can't be changed because they are in use

I was editing in Avid Media composer (8.1) and closed the program. When i plugged my hard rive in the next day I had the following message: "OS X can't repair the disk "LaCie". You can still open or copy files on the disk, but you can't save changes to files on the disk. Back up the disk and reformat it as soon as you can". Then when i open Avid, my timeline can't open.


I've bought a new hard rive and I'm trying to transfer my entire old hard drive onto it (footage, sound effects and Avid files). When i try to copy it, i get this message : "One or more items in "file name" can't be changed because they are in use."

The "file name" is the document where my Avid project is (my footage, audio and media project).


I have no idea what to do from there, can anybody help?
